2023年6月29日发(作者:)
vtp与市面流行的自动化测试软件的比较HP UFT(HP Unified Functional Testing)/(原为QTP)测试类型:功能测试适用于:界面测试,api测试,业务流程测试,业务流程流特点:用于执行重复的手动测试,主要适用于回归测试和测试同一软件的新版本。使用范围往往是核心业务流程,或者重复执行率比较高的业务。自动回归测试方便可靠,可运行更多更繁琐的测试,且快速高效。尤其适合需要反复测试,如可靠性测试,需要进行上千次的系统测试的情形自动化测试脚本和测试用例具有可复用性。可在多环境下测试。可测试windows应用程序,Web应用可以做业务执行结果是否正确进行测试,通过对执行结果设置检查点进行对比,能够检查执行结果是否正确测试用例的选择,一般以正向为主。使用复杂,对测试人员的技术要求更高,高于一般测试人员。需要使用者需要有比较好的编程基础和能力,并进行较长时间的培训学习。使用者需要熟悉各种相关的软件系统,而且必须具备复杂问题的处理能力。录制,编写、调试代码的时间很长。一项自动化测试测试,通常需要花,很长的时间做测试前的准备,包括,测试需求的确定,自动化测试框架的设计,测试脚本的编写,和调试。测试用例需要预先设计,逐个输入系统。用例可以重复使用和调用不能完全取代人工,手工测试。价格高,成本投入过高,风险大。以下情况不适合UFT自动化测试:一是项目周期短,需求变更频繁二是在软件版本还没有稳定的情况三系统中存在大批量第三方控件或测试对象无法识别因为需要编写调试代码和用例,因此只有在适合使用UFT测试工具的情况下能够缩短测试周期,提高测试效率VTP测试类型:功能测试包括: 画面测试(含疏通测试,横展开测试,版本升级测试,兼容性测试,回归测试);业务分支覆盖测试(含单体测试,集成测试,验收测试,稳定性测试,录制流程扩展测试);其他类型的测试特点:快速高效自动化测试,自动生成测试任务,自动生成测试用例,自动执行测试,自动生成测试报告,自动分析测试结果,适用于各个阶段各个环境的测试快速高效自动化测试,适用于Web应用的各种测试录制的用例及生成的测试任务具有可复用性可在多环境下测试只测试Web应用不能直接检验业务执行结果是否正确,能够通过对业务执行结果的统计分析间接判断业务执行结果是否正确(我们的1.0版本系统和3.0版本系统能够直接检验业务执行结果是否正确)测试用例的选择,包含正向和反向使用极其简单,对测试人员的技术要求低,低于一般测试人员。不需要编程基础和编程能力不需要编写和调试代码,只需要录制一次操作并回放,就可以设定测试任务进行测试,简单易用,高效不需要自己设计编写用例,系统自动生成测试用例不能完全取代人工,手工测试。价格低,成本投入小,无风险无论项目周期长短,需求变更是否频繁,软件版本是否稳定,均适合使用。尤其是在上述这些情况下,VTP更体现出与其他自动化测试软件的优势不需要编写调试代码和用例,几乎在任何情况下都能大幅缩短测试周期,提高测试效率
发布者:admin,转转请注明出处:http://www.yc00.com/xiaochengxu/1688021361a67475.html
评论列表(0条)